What did the rich of ancient Egypt wear?

The ancient Egyptians wore linen clothing. The rich wore the softest linen made of fine fibers. The poor and peasants wore coarser linen made of thicker fibers.

What is the name of the Egyptian dress?

The clothes worn by both sexes in Egypt were called Kalasiris by Herodotus. The material and the cut have changed over the centuries, even if the chosen fabric has always been linen. The kalasiris worn by women can cover one or both shoulders or be worn with braces.

What kind of jewelry did ancient Egypt wear?

The Egyptians wore necklaces, bracelets, heavy chains, pendants, earrings, rings and special buttons on their clothing. Wealthy Egyptians wore jewelry made from precious jewels and gold. Ordinary people could not afford this luxury, so they wore brightly colored pearl jewelry.

What is a Kalasiris?

Kalasiris. The most distinctive and important piece of clothing that women wore in the history of ancient Egypt was the kalasiris, a long linen robe. In its earliest form, the Kalasiris was a tight tubular garment that was sewn on the side and held by two ribbons tied around the neck.

Where did the ancient Egyptian nobles live?

Nobles: Nobles lived in large houses or villas on the Nile. They painted the exterior of their houses white because it kept the house cooler. The very wealthy covered the exterior of their houses with white limestone.

What weapons did ancient Egypt use?

The typical weapons of ancient Egypt were bows and arrows, spears, laces, maces, daggers and throwing sticks. Weapons of stone and wood were used very early.
